Background technology
Computing machine is a kind of robot calculator device for supercomputing, and can carry out numerical evaluation, can carry out logical calculated again, also have store-memory function, it can run according to program, automatically, the modernization intelligent electronic device of high speed processing mass data.Computing machine is made up of hardware system and software systems, and the computing machine not installing any software is called bare machine.Generally can be divided into supercomputer, industrial control computer, network computer, personal computer, embedded computer five class, more advanced computing machine has biocomputer, photonic computer, quantum computer etc.Computing machine creates extremely important impact to the activity in production of the mankind and social activities, and with powerful vitality develop rapidly.Its application is from initial military research application extension to the every field of society, define huge computer industry, drive the technical progress of global range, cause deep social change thus, computing machine is throughout general school, enterprises and institutions, enter common people house, become requisite instrument in information society.
Computing machine is mainly made up of hardware system and software systems two parts.Computer hardware system is mainly some electron devices, and it comprises power supply, hard disk, mainboard and video card.Reliability and the temperature of electron device are closely related, and typical temperature often raises 1 DEG C, and the crash rate of electron device will rise 2% ~ 3%, and the reliability thus improving electron device will take necessary cooling measure.Computer heat radiating device major part on existing market utilizes the radiator fan of computer-internal that the air that extraneous relative temperature reduces is introduced cabinet inside, comes to lower the temperature to electron device by the type of cooling of Forced Air Convection.When radiator fan sucks outside air, also the impurity such as dust, tiny fiber have been brought into cabinet, make the flabellum of radiator fan to deposited the more abundant dust of one deck, radiator fan slewing rate under given power is reduced, reduce the intensity of cooling of Forced Air Convection, make radiator fan radiating effect poor, the reliability of electron device reduces.
Utility model content
For the deficiency that prior art exists, the utility model provides a kind of heat-radiating chassis for computer, is convenient to dismantle radiator fan, remove the dust on radiator fan, strengthen the intensity of cooling of Forced Air Convection, increase the radiating effect of radiator fan, improve the reliability of electron device.
In order to achieve the above object, the utility model is achieved through the following technical solutions: a kind of heat-radiating chassis for computer, comprise case box, the top of described case box is provided with cabinet cover plate, power supply, hard disk, mainboard and video card is provided with in described case box, mount pad is provided with in described case box, described mount pad comprises the first installation side plate, second and installs side plate and base plate, the two ends of described base plate are longitudinally provided with web joint, the middle part of described base plate is longitudinally provided with dividing plate, and described dividing plate is located between described web joint; Described base plate is provided with radiator fan, and one end of described radiator fan is limited on described web joint, and the other end of described radiator fan is supported on described dividing plate; Described first installs side plate is provided with hinge, and described hinge through is connected with rotor plate, and described rotor plate is located at the top of described web joint, described dividing plate; Described second installs side plate is provided with fixed head, and described fixed head is provided with support bar, and described support bar is provided with rotating shaft, described rotating shaft is rotatably connected to pressing plate, the top of described support bar is provided with limited block, and described limited block props up described pressing plate, and described rotor plate pushed down by described pressing plate.
The utility model is set to further: the side of described case box is provided with the first louvre.Electron device in case box operationally produces heat, owing to arranging the first louvre in the side of case box, case box inside and the external world are interconnected, by cross-ventilation, the heat in case box is taken out of, air colder for the external world is introduced, can lower the temperature to electron device, improve the reliability of electron device.
The utility model is set to further: described cabinet cover plate is provided with bolt hole.When carrying out capping to case box, only need in bolt hole, pass into the installation that bolt can complete cabinet cover plate, easy for installation, simple, save labour.
The utility model is set to further: the side of described web joint is provided with spacing preiection, and the outside of described radiator fan is provided with housing, and described housing is provided with stopper slot, and described stopper slot and described spacing preiection match.Snap onto on spacing preiection by stopper slot, the housing of radiator fan outside is spacing on web joint, so just radiator fan stably can be placed on base plate, when radiator fan removed by needs, only need radiator fan upwards to shift out from spacing preiection, convenient disassembly is simple, time saving and energy saving, be conducive to carrying out dedusting work to radiator fan, the dust on the flabellum of removing radiator fan, increase the radiating effect of radiator fan, improve the reliability of electron device.
The utility model is set to further: described dividing plate is provided with the second louvre.Radiator fan operationally also can produce heat, because dividing plate is provided with the second louvre, the space of two placement radiator fans is communicated, working environment residing for such radiator fan is consistent, prevent radiator fan be in overheated working environment and burn out, improve the serviceable life of radiator fan.
The utility model is set to further: the side of described dividing plate is provided with heat radiator.The material of heat radiator is copper and aluminium alloy, heat radiator has heat absorption capacity and thermal conduction capability, the heat that radiator fan self produces can be transmitted on heat radiator effectively, be dispersed in the working environment in case box again through heat radiator, can carry out thermolysis to radiator fan like this, ensure that radiator fan is to the heat radiation work of complete machine.
The utility model is set to further: described limited block is provided with spacing hole, and described spacing hole and described support bar match.The shape of spacing hole is consistent with the shape of the xsect of support bar, and such spacing hole can slide on support bar, makes limited block in the enterprising line slip of support bar, to facilitate limited block to the position-limiting action of pressing plate.
The utility model is set to further: the bottom of described limited block is provided with elastic clamping block, and described elastic clamping block is provided with draw-in groove, and described draw-in groove is stuck in described rotating shaft.When limited block pushes down pressing plate, the easy displacement occurred longitudinally, cause the compression dynamics of limited block to pressing plate general, when the draw-in groove in elastic clamping block snaps in rotating shaft, can by spacing for limited block in rotating shaft, make limited block clamping platen, and draw-in groove can prevent axis of rotation, such pressing plate can push down rotor plate.
The utility model has beneficial effect: in mount pad, arrange two radiator fans, two radiator fans introduce cabinet inside the air that extraneous relative temperature reduces, come to lower the temperature to electron device by the type of cooling of Forced Air Convection, when deposited the more abundant dust of one deck on the flabellum of radiator fan, user can take out limited block from the top of support bar, then pressing plate is turned an angle in rotating shaft, pressing plate does not play pressuring action to rotor plate, because first installs side plate and rotor plate chain connection, then rotor plate is installed on side plate first and turn an angle, so just, radiator fan upwards can be shifted out from spacing preiection, i.e. dismountable radiator fan, user can carry out hairbrush dedusting work to radiator fan, just can be installed in mount pad after dedusting, effectively can remove the dust on radiator fan, strengthen the intensity of cooling of Forced Air Convection, increase the radiating effect of radiator fan, improve the reliability of electron device, and the second louvre is set in dividing plate, the space of two placement radiator fans is communicated, working environment residing for such radiator fan is consistent, radiator fan is prevented to be in overheated working environment and to burn out, improve the serviceable life of radiator fan, heat radiator is set in the side of dividing plate simultaneously, the material of heat radiator is copper and aluminium alloy, heat radiator has heat absorption capacity and thermal conduction capability, the heat that radiator fan self produces can be transmitted on heat radiator effectively, be dispersed in the working environment in case box again through heat radiator, can carry out thermolysis to radiator fan self like this, ensure that radiator fan is to the heat radiation work of complete machine.
